We work hard to make sure people love their work here. Many have been with us from the very beginning. Because we’re physician-owned, we understand the value of having a well-trained, well-resourced staff. When it comes to procedural healthcare, experience matters.

Lubbock Heart & Surgical Hospital specializes in the care of cardiac, orthopedic, nephrology, urology, and general medical patients. We are also a highly active inpatient center mainly centered on surgical procedures that include cardiothoracic, orthopedic, urology, and general surgery. We have a 24-hour Emergency Department with 5 fully equipped ED rooms, 4 fully operating OR rooms, 4 cardiac catherization labs with 1 electrophysiology room, 11-day surgery rooms, 58 acute care beds spread over three units, and 16 cardiac critical care rooms. We pride ourselves on giving the best overall care possible to our patients and on our family style atmosphere that includes everyone: patients and their families, physicians, and our employees.

LHSH Nursing Administration: PRN

Job Summary

Primarily responsible for the day-to-day clinical operations of an assigned area. Participates in direct care about 75% of the time, with the remaining 25% involving managerial tasks. Collaborates with other staff in sharing of resources, as well as assists in the cross-functional training of the staff. Assumes the leader role in the hospital during his/her shift.

Minimum Education and Experience

  • Graduate of an accredited program of nursing
  • Minimum of 3 years’ continuous clinical experience in a critical/acute care setting with at least 2 years of recent management experience preferred.
  • Licensed as a Registered Nurse (RN) in the state of Texas.
